Energy Efficient Mac Protocol for Wireless Sensor Networks: Tdma-based Congestion Avoidance Mac Protocol

If many data packets are generated to transmit at once, the existing TDMA-based protocols in general wireless networks can transfer data packets to the sink node without collision and congestion, because the nodes are scheduled for different time slots in order to communicate with their neighboring nodes. The general TDMA-based schemes should, however, be modi-fied for wireless sensor networks since each node must turn off its radio during idle listening for precious power savings. In this thesis, we propose an enhanced TDMA-based MAC protocol for energy-efficiency in wireless sensor networks. The proposed MAC scheme reduces energy consumption by using power gate packet that allows the receive node to predict its schedule of data reception. Through the elaborate analysis and simulation using sensor module, the results show that the proposed scheme meets the requirement for both throughput and power saving.
